Sasuke Recovery Arc isn't original. It's pretty Shonen to a T. Characters have to split off to handle enemies by themselves with a ticking clock element. Enemies from the past come back as reinforcements.
It's nothing new.
But god fucking damn it, if Kishi didn't write it perfectly. It's one of if not my favorite arc in Naruto. Everything, from the early foreshadowing of Kimimaro to Sasuke and Naruto fighting, is insanely well written. It makes you care about Choji, it gets you cheering for Neji, it has Lee and fucking Gaara working together and Gaara repeatedly saving Lee's life.
Not to say Enies Lobby is a bad arc. I think it's really good for the emotional stakes, the conclusion to the Merry plotline, Robin's backstory, etc. But Naruto feels a lot more visceral and real here. I care more about Naruto & Sasuke's friendship and this hastily thrown together team than Robin.
So for me, Sasuke Recovery Arc all the way.
